It is with profoundly heavy hearts and deep sadness that the family of George Burns

announce his sudden passing on June 18, 2025, at age 63. George passed away at

Aurora Medical Center in Oshkosh and was surrounded and held in love by his wife

Bonita, brother Tim, and sister-in-law Kris.

George was born on September 8,1961, the son of Richard and Marie (Petersen)

Burns. George graduated high school and took some college classes before entering a

long career of 25 years at Goodwill Industries, as the Vice President of Facilities, where

he was instrumental in the growth and development of new stores and programs in the

Northeastern Wisconsin region. George went on to work in real estate development

and construction with his brother, Tim, at Goodlife assisted living.

George married his loving, adoring wife, Bonita on March 8, 2003. They married in

Newfoundland, Canada. They built their life together in Oshkosh, Wisconsin while

thoroughly enjoying their trips back to family in Canada. They shared an exceptional life

together as best friends and they were inseparable.

George had a huge heart and was adored and loved by everyone who knew him. He

was always there to lend a helping hand and could fix anything. He truly enjoyed his

Harley Davidson motorcycles, playing cards with friends and occasional trips to the

casino. George had a smile that was contagious, he spread kindness everywhere he

went and will be immensely missed by all.
